tags:
- name: Strings
description: 'A string is a piece of translation. Based on the source content, strings
can be parsed differently. A string is then broken down further, into one
or more segments.
The Strings API allows you to directly upload strings to a Smartling
project and fetch original strings or translations.
For each string in a Smartling project, there is a unique identifier
created by hashing together the parsed string text, [variant
metadata](https://help.smartling.com/hc/en-us/articles/360008143853), and
in some cases,
[namespace](https://help.smartling.com/hc/en-us/articles/360008143833).
When adding strings via the Strings API, each string will be unique. If
you try to create a string with identical variant metadata and string text
to a string that already exists in the project, the string will be
overwritten.'

/strings-api/v2/projects/{projectId}:
post:
summary: Add strings
description: 'Uploads an array of strings to a Smartling project. A maximum of 100 strings can be created per request. A request with more than 100 items will return an error. Each string has a character limit of 10,000.
**Note**: You cannot authorize a string via API. Once you have created the strings, they will need to be authorized by a content owner in the Smartling Dashboard.
Smartling creates a unique hashcode for each string based on the parsed string text and any variant or namespace metadata provided. If you upload a string with the same text, variant and namespace, and therefore the same hashcode, the existng string will be overwritten. This will not change the text of the string, but may update other metadata, such as placeholder and callback values. If the string is currently inactive, overwriting it will cause it to be reactivated. Overwritten strings return `"overWritten": "true"` in the response object.
Most uploads will return a `200` response indicating success. If processing the request takes longer than 60 seconds, a `202` request will be returned, including a `processUid` value that can be used to check on the progress of the request.
If you set up a POST callback for the string, you can automatically receive the translation for a string as soon as it is complete. See [Callbacks](https://help.smartling.com/hc/en-us/articles/1260805504109) for more details.'

/strings-api/v2/projects/{projectId}/processes/{processUid}:
get:
summary: Check string status
description: "If an **Add strings** request takes longer than 60 seconds to process, a `202` response will be returned, indicating that the process of creating strings is continuing but not yet complete. This response will include a `proccessUid` value which can be used to check the progress of the request.\n\nThis request can return:\n * `\"processState\": \"OPEN\"` which indicates that the request is still continuing.\n * `\"processState\": \"CLOSED\"` indicates the request has successfully completed.\n * `\"processState\": \"FAILED\"` means the request could not be completed.\n\nProcesses have a limited lifespan after they are complete. This request will fail if you specify an expired `processUid`."

/strings-api/v2/projects/{projectId}/source-strings:
get:
summary: List all source strings
description: 'Returns source strings from Smartling. You can get strings by specifying a file you want strings for, or you can specify individual strings by hashcode.
_If you do not specify at least one of these parameters (`hashcodes` or `fileUri`) no results will be returned._
**Note**: If you use this call to get strings that are not added via the Strings API, you may see differences in the response.
You may see a value for `parsedStringText` but a `null` value for `stringText`. The `stringText` records the raw input received by the Strings API, and therefore will only appear for strings uploaded via the Strings API.
If you are getting a GDN string, the original placeholder values you used will not be returned as these are not saved by Smartling. GDN strings will have placeholders in the format `{0}`, `{1}`, etc.'

/strings-api/v2/projects/{projectId}/translations:
get:
summary: List all translations
description: 'Returns translated strings from Smartling. You can get translations by specifying a file you want strings for, or you can specify individual strings by hashcode.
_If you do not specify at least one of these parameters (`hashcodes` or `fileUri`) no results will be returned._
**Note**: If you use this call to get strings that were not created via the Strings API, you may see differences in the response.
Only authorized and active strings will be returned. Excluded, unauthorized, and inactive strings will not be returned.
You may see a value for `parsedStringText` but a `null` value for `stringText`. The `stringText` records the raw input received by the Strings API, and therefore will only appear for strings uploaded via the Strings API.
If you are getting a GDN string, the original placeholder values you used will not be returned as these are not saved by Smartling. GDN strings will have placeholders in the format `{0}`, `{1}`, etc.'
